Comic Book Preview – Buffy the Vampire Slayer: Willow #4

October 13, 2020 by Amie Cranswick

Boom! Studios releases Buffy the Vampire Slayer: Willow #4 this Wednesday, and we’ve got the official preview of the issue for you here; take a look…

Willow had discovered something rotten at the heart of Abhainn – and now her newfound friends may become her enemies! To escape with her life, Willow will tap into powers she never knew she had to save herself – and her soul.

Buffy the Vampire Slayer: Willow #4 goes on sale on October 14th, priced $3.99.
